Assay Detail

CHEMBL5136367

Review assay metadata, readout intent, target linkage, and publication context from the same page.

Binding
Inhibition of full-length wild type LRRK2 (unknown origin) using LRRKtide as substrate incubated for 1 hr in presence of ATP by TR-FRET based ADAPTA assay
